Vital Signs is a 1990 drama film that revolves around a group of medical students and their daily lives as they strive to become doctors. The movie takes place in a fictional medical school, and it portrays the challenges that the students face as they juggle their studies, personal lives, and medical ethics. The central character of the movie is Michael Chatham, played by Adrian Pasdar, who is a brilliant medical student with a promising future. Michael is charming, confident, and ambitious. He is also engaged to his high school sweetheart and fellow medical student, a beautiful and intelligent woman named Gina Wyler, played by Diane Lane.

As the story unfolds, the movie shows the medical school environment, which is highly competitive and demanding. Students are expected to work long hours, study relentlessly, and exhibit exceptional bedside manners. They are also expected to conduct themselves with integrity and abide by the ethical standards of the medical profession.
